Frequently Asked Questions about Williams Park

How much are Studio apartments in Williams Park?

There are currently 21 Studio Apartments in Williams Park with rent ranges from $650 to $857 with an average price of $817.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Williams Park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Williams Park ranges from $649 to $1,162 with an average monthly rent of $904.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Williams Park c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Williams Park range from $650 to $1,478.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,034.

How expensive are Williams Park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 27 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Williams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$960 to $1,700 - averaging $1,297 for the location.
